C++
u014766462
这个作者很懒,什么都没留下…
展开
-
深入理解C++的动态绑定和静态绑定
深入理解C++的动态绑定和静态绑定#广州# OSC源创会第31期(12月27日)开始报名,OSC自曝家丑!为了支持c++的多态性,才用了动态绑定和静态绑定。理解他们的区别有助于更好的理解多态性,以及在编程的过程中避免犯错误,需要理解四个名词:1、对象的静态类型:对象在声明时采用的类型。是在编译期确定的。2、对象的动态类型:目前所指对象的类型。是在运行期决定的转载 2014-12-23 13:07:26 · 428 阅读 · 0 评论 -
静态绑定与动态绑定
C++学习笔记(15)——静态绑定与动态绑定 分类: C++研究2008-03-12 00:2512773人阅读评论(2)收藏举报c++class语言目录(?)[+]静态绑定与动态绑定例编写程序观察虚函数和非虚函数的绑定行为本博客(http://blog.csdn.net/livelylittlefi转载 2014-12-23 13:11:46 · 399 阅读 · 0 评论 -
C++ 虚函数表解析
C++ 虚函数表解析陈皓http://blog.csdn.net/haoel前言C++中的虚函数的作用主要是实现了多态的机制。关于多态,简而言之就是用父类型别的指针指向其子类的实例,然后通过父类的指针调用实际子类的成员函数。这种技术可以让父类的指针有“多种形态”,这是一种泛型技术。所谓泛型技术,说白了就是试图使用不变的代码来实现可变的算法。比如:模板技术,RTTI技术,虚函数技术,转载 2014-12-23 13:24:00 · 460 阅读 · 0 评论 -
我们从工程项目中学习什么?
这个题目有点大,我在此仅限于技术层面。 这篇文章呢很早就想写,真正促使我付诸行动的是大约两个月前我开始给Mimas team讲街机模拟器的设计,大家普遍很漠然,大概完全搞不懂我为什么要讲这种东东,而且还是用离嵌入式开发工程师似乎很遥远的JavaScript / HTML。我的本意是想通过一个不是太复杂而且具备一转载 2015-06-02 11:04:01 · 6779 阅读 · 0 评论